When diagnosing an AC issue in a 2022 Nissan Versa, start by checking the air filters, as clean filters are essential for proper airflow and cooling efficiency. Next, inspect the refrigerant levels; low refrigerant can significantly hinder the AC's performance, so ensure they are within the recommended range. Following this, examine the AC compressor for any visible signs of damage or wear, as a malfunctioning compressor can lead to inadequate cooling. Additionally, test the thermostat to confirm it is accurately regulating the vehicle's temperature. Finally, look for any leaks in the AC system, as these can cause refrigerant loss and further impact cooling performance. By systematically addressing these areas, you can effectively diagnose and potentially resolve AC issues in your Nissan Versa.
When the air conditioning system in a 2022 Nissan Versa stops working, it can be a significant inconvenience, particularly in warm weather. Several common issues may be at play, starting with low refrigerant levels, which can severely limit the system's cooling capabilities. If you notice that the AC isn't blowing cold air, checking the refrigerant level is a good first step, as low levels often indicate a leak that needs to be fixed. Another frequent problem is a faulty compressor; if the compressor fails, it won't circulate refrigerant effectively, leading to poor cooling performance. Additionally, electrical issues such as blown fuses or damaged wiring can disrupt the AC's operation, so inspecting these components is crucial. A clogged or leaking condenser can also hinder the cooling process, as it plays a vital role in dissipating heat from the refrigerant. Lastly, if the cooling fans are not functioning correctly, they can restrict airflow, further diminishing the AC's effectiveness. For those looking to tackle these issues themselves, understanding these common problems is essential for effective troubleshooting, although consulting a qualified mechanic is often recommended for a comprehensive diagnosis and repair to ensure the AC system operates efficiently.
